Whole House Fan Installation in Heber City, UT

Whole house fan installation is a service that involves setting up a ventilation system designed to improve airflow throughout a home. These fans are typically installed in the attic and work by drawing cooler outdoor air into the living spaces while exhausting warm indoor air, helping to reduce indoor temperatures and improve air quality. Projects often include replacing or upgrading existing fans, installing new systems in homes without prior ventilation, or optimizing airflow in properties seeking better temperature regulation during warmer months.

Homeowners interested in this service usually want to understand the size and capacity of the fan needed for their specific property, as well as how the installation process might affect their existing attic space and ventilation setup. It’s also common to inquire about the compatibility with current insulation, the potential impact on energy efficiency, and any considerations for maintaining the system over time. Whole House Fan Installation Questions

What is a whole house fan? A whole house fan is a ventilation system designed to cool a home by drawing in outdoor air and exhausting indoor heat through attic vents.

How does a whole house fan improve indoor comfort? It helps reduce indoor temperatures quickly and effectively by increasing airflow and promoting natural cooling.

Where is a whole house fan installed? Typically, it is installed in the ceiling of the upper story or attic to facilitate proper airflow throughout the home.

What types of homes are suitable for a whole house fan? Many single-family homes and residences with attic access can benefit from the installation of a whole house fan.
